""A Theatre of Scottish Worthies: And The Life, Doings and Death of William Elphinston, Bishop of Aberdeen"" is a historical book written by Alexander Garden. The book is a collection of biographies of notable Scottish figures, including kings, queens, statesmen, and scholars, who have made significant contributions to Scottish history and culture. The book also includes a detailed account of the life, achievements, and death of William Elphinston, who served as the Bishop of Aberdeen in the 15th century. The author provides an in-depth analysis of the political and cultural landscape of Scotland during Elphinston's time and explores the role of the Church in shaping the country's history.
